Coffee bean quality ranking: evaluation and selection methods of top coffee beans

Coffee beans are the key raw material for making coffee, and their quality directly affects the taste and flavor of coffee. There are many different grades of coffee beans available on the market. This article will focus on the evaluation and selection methods of top-grade coffee beans, and introduce how to identify and purchase high-quality coffee beans.

First of all, top-quality coffee beans are usually of high quality and unique flavor. These beans usually come from high-quality producing areas and are carefully planted, picked and processed. Generally speaking, Arabica is the most popular and considered to be the highest quality coffee bean. They usually have a smooth and moderately acidic taste with a rich and complex aroma.

Secondly, when choosing top-quality coffee beans, you should pay attention to factors such as appearance, aroma, and roasting degree. First of all, you should pay attention to check whether there are any defects or damage, such as cracks, insects, or mold. In addition, when smelling, you should look for a strong and pleasant aroma, which is usually one of the important indicators of coffee bean quality. Finally, the roasting degree will also affect the flavor of the coffee beans. Different degrees of roasting will produce different taste and flavor characteristics, and from light roasting to dark roasting, each has its own pursuers.

Finally, when choosing top-quality coffee beans, you should also consider factors such as origin and cultivation methods. Some regions are famous for their special climate conditions and soil quality, such as Colombia, Brazil, Ethiopia, etc. The coffee beans produced in these places often have a unique and elegant flavor. In addition, organic cultivation and sustainable development have also become one of the factors that more and more consumers pay attention to. Choose coffee that is certified or marked with sustainable cultivation methods, which respects the environment during picking and processing and pays farmers fairly.


In summary, when buying top-quality coffee beans, we need to pay attention to the following aspects: quality and flavor, appearance and aroma, and factors such as origin and planting methods. By carefully observing and smelling, and understanding the characteristics of different production areas and planting methods, we can better choose top-quality coffee beans that suit our taste. Excellent quality coffee beans will bring us a unique and delicious coffee experience.
